Understanding the Core Mechanics of Chicken Navigation
At its heart, the chicken road game is about timing and risk assessment. Players must accurately judge the gaps between vehicles and time their chicken’s movements to safely cross the road. It’s not simply a matter of running blindly; players need to observe the patterns of traffic, anticipate the movements of individual cars, and react accordingly. Different vehicles may have varying speeds and trajectories, adding another layer of complexity to the challenge. Successfully navigating these hazards requires focus and precision. The game often features power-ups, like temporary invincibility or speed boosts, that can aid in the perilous journey. Learning how to best utilize these power-ups is crucial for surviving the later, more difficult levels.
The Role of Grains in Scoring and Strategy
Collecting grains scattered along the road isn’t just about padding the score; it’s a core element of the game’s strategic depth. Grains provide points, and a higher score unlocks new chicken characters or cosmetic items. Furthermore, some variations of the game might feature multipliers that increase the value of collected grains for a limited time. This encourages players to take calculated risks, venturing into slightly more dangerous areas to gather as many grains as possible. The decision of whether to prioritize safety or maximize point collection adds an interesting layer of decision-making to each playthrough. The skillful balance between safety and greed is a key to success.

The Role of Risk-Reward Mechanics
The dynamic between risk and reward is central to the chicken road game’s appeal. Players are constantly faced with decisions that involve balancing safety and pursuing higher scores. Venturing into more dangerous areas to collect grains offers the potential for greater rewards, but also carries a higher risk of being hit by traffic. This creates a constant tension that keeps players on the edge of their seats. The game rewards calculated risks, encouraging players to push their limits and experiment with different strategies. The satisfaction of successfully navigating a particularly challenging section of road, after taking a calculated risk, is a key component of the game’s addictive loop. The feeling of “almost making it” also motivates repeated attempts.
- Assess Traffic Patterns: Observe the movement of vehicles before making a move.
- Time Your Movements: Accurately judge the gaps between cars.
- Collect Grains Strategically: Prioritize grains that are easily accessible without taking excessive risks.
- Utilize Power-Ups Wisely: Save power-ups for challenging sections of the road.
Following these steps can significantly improve a player's performance and increase their chances of survival in the game. Consistent practice and strategic thinking are key to mastering the chicken road game.
